The last decade has taught people some wrong lessons on how long they should take before launching a product. I feel like often these infinitely closed wait lists are kind of a negative sign that the traction may not be real. If you have such raw organic adoption, usually you just open the thing up because you know more and more people join unless again there's some constraint that prevents you from doing it.
